At first, I thought I had discovered something alive beneath my bed. My heart started racing the moment I spotted the pale, curved object lying motionless against the dusty floorboards. It looked disturbingly organic — soft, slightly twisted, with a dark pointed tip that immediately made my imagination spiral into worst-case scenarios. Every second I stared at it, the object seemed to become more horrifying. Was it some kind of parasite? A dead rodent tail? A rotting creature that had somehow crawled into the house unnoticed? The longer I looked, the more my stomach tightened.

I called my son over, hoping he would instantly recognize it and laugh at my panic. Instead, he froze beside me and squinted at it with the same uneasy confusion. “What is that?” he whispered. Hearing uncertainty in his voice made everything feel worse. Children usually identify ordinary things quickly. If even he looked disturbed, maybe my fear wasn’t irrational after all.

Neither of us wanted to touch it. We stood several feet away, analyzing it like investigators at a crime scene. The room suddenly felt dirtier than it had minutes earlier. I started mentally replaying every strange smell, every creak in the walls, every tiny thing I had ignored over the past few weeks. My imagination moved fast. Maybe something had died under the furniture. Maybe insects had gotten into the house. Maybe we had been sleeping only feet away from something disgusting for days.
